CASTOR: Normal-Mode Analysis of Resistive MHD Plasmas☆

The CASTOR (complex Alfven spectrum of toroidal plasmas) code computes the entire spectrum of normal-modes in resistive MHD for general tokamak configurations. The applied Galerkin method, in conjunction with a Fourier finite-element discretisation, leads to a large scale eigenvalue problem A (x) under bar = lambda B (x) under bar, where A is a nonself-adjoint matrix.
